Cloud powered tool to estimate rooftop solar power potential

The Energy and Resources Institute (TERI) is currently developing the first-of-kind cloud-based open-source Web-GIS tool for estimating rooftop solar power potential for Indian cities. The main objective of this exercise is to develop a high-performing, flexible Web-GIS tool to estimate the rooftop solar power potential for Chandigarh.
This is considered as an important step to promote solar rooftop photovoltaic (PV) systems in Indian cities. There is a need for a tool to showcase solar resource potential in a user-friendly format so that users can investigate their locations of interest and perform pre-processed analysis. Geographic Information System (GIS) is the obvious tool to achieve this because it provides visual reference — a map of the entire city, showing the buildings having solar PV installation potential.
The tool was recently demonstrated during the workshop entitled “Promoting Rooftop Solar Photovoltaic Systems in India” organised by TERI.
Amit Kumar, Director, Energy Environment Technology Development, said, “TERI started working on development of this tool, realising the felt need for the same, especially given the ambitious programmes on solar rooftop systems under Jawaharlal Nehru National Solar Mission as well as under states’ policies. While similar tools were available in countries like Germany and USA, nothing of sort was available in India. Going further, TERI aimed at a tool that can be used by anyone rather than only those having access to proprietary software.”
The proposed rooftop Web-GIS tool for India will be an ideal medium to showcase investors the logistics of rooftop solar energy investment. This tool will have the following benefits: It will enable user to estimate the rooftop solar power potential of selected area or, buildings for a particular location w.r.t. various SPV technologies such as, crystalline, thin film etc.
Will act as a decision support system (DSS) to carry out the pre-feasibility assessment of putting rooftop PV system for a particular location
Will help users estimate potential GHG mitigation through solar rooftop route for a given location/building
Assess the viability of any rooftop projects based on possible business models and financial schemes available.
After successful demonstration of this rooftop solar Web-GIS tool on a pilot-basis, the quantifiable and tangible benefits can be showcased for other cities too. This tool can work as a base platform, which can be replicated for other cities by creating the GIS data layers for the target city and integrating those with the existing tool, without having any additional development efforts.
